Development of a new partnership with the Centre for Research Equity

HSC R&D Division were pleased to join Professor Cathy Harrison, the Chief Pharmaceutical Officer (Department of Health) in welcoming Professor Mahendra Patel to Northern Ireland on 1st February 2024 to discuss the development of a new partnership with the Centre for Research Equity (CfRE). The CfRE's mission is to advance the understanding of and improve inclusive research practice and community engagement in health and care research and is based in the University of Oxford's Nuffield Department of Primary Care Health Sciences. The proposed collaborative voluntary partnership with the CfRE and partners in NI is designed to enhance inclusive research practices and community engagement.
 
The event brought together key stakeholders from across the research, policy and voluntary sector to discuss how to further develop and support equitable research for Northern Ireland, and identify key priority areas for knowledge sharing and learning.

What is being planned?

  • Support and training for research and support staff to increase health equity.
  • Evidencing and sharing the benefits for community-based recruitment and trial design.
  • Building on the evidence base around the determinants of health inequalities, proposing methods and research design to improve outcomes for all.
  • Supporting inclusive community engagement, involvement and participation in research.

Further updates will be shared as the partnership progresses.
